    Mapping of the immunodominant regions of the NAD-dependent formate dehydrogenase

    AbstractA panel of 4 monoclonal antibodies and 7 polyclonal antisera against NAD-dependent formate dehydrogenase from methylotrophic bacterium Pseudomonas sp. 101 has been obtained. The reactivity of the 37 overlapping proteolytic peptides with the monoclonal antibodies and polyclonal antisera has been studied with ELISA test. The data obtained were interpreted residing on the structural model of the formate dehydrogenase at 3 Å resolution. The immunodominant regions in the formate dehydrogenase molecule and the epitopes for the monoclonal antibodies were elucidated

    Nonmonotonic Decay of Nonequilibrium Polariton Condensate in Direct-Gap Semiconductors

    Time evolution of a nonequilibrium polariton condensate has been studied in the framework of a microscopic approach. It has been shown that due to polariton-polariton scattering a significant condensate depletion takes place in a comparatively short time interval. The condensate decay occurs in the form of multiple echo signals. Distribution-function dynamics of noncondensate polaritons have been investigated. It has been shown that at the initial stage of evolution the distribution function has the form of a bell. Then oscillations arise in the contour of the distribution function, which further transform into small chaotic ripples. The appearance of a short-wavelength wing of the distribution function has been demonstrated.     Planar Graphical Models which are Easy

    We describe a rich family of binary variables statistical mechanics models on a given planar graph which are equivalent to Gaussian Grassmann Graphical models (free fermions) defined on the same graph. Calculation of the partition function (weighted counting) for such a model is easy (of polynomial complexity) as reducible to evaluation of a Pfaffian of a matrix of size equal to twice the number of edges in the graph.     Economic Ideas and Institutional Change: Evidence from Soviet Economic Discourse 1987-1991

    In recent years, institutional and evolutionary economists have become increasingly aware that ideas play an important role in economic development. In the current literature, the problem is usually elaborated upon in purely theoretical terms. In the present paper it is argued that ideas are always also shaped by historical and cultural factors. Due to this historical and cultural specificity theoretical research must be supplemented by historical case studies. The paper analyses the shift in ideas that took place in Soviet economic thought between 1987 and 1991. This case study, it is argued, may contribute to our understanding of the links between ideas and institutions. More specifically, it sheds new light on the issue of whether the evolution of economic ideas is pathdependent, so that they change only incrementally, or whether their development takes place in a discontinuous way that can best be compared with revolutions

    Instability of Democracy as Resource Curse

    We suggest a dynamic game theoretic model to explain why resource abundance may lead to instability of democracy. Stationary Markov perfect equilibria of this game with four players – Politician, Oligarch, Autocrat and Public (voters) – are analyzed. Choosing a rate of resource rent tax, potential Autocrat competes with conventional Politician for the office, and Oligarch, the owner of the resource wealth, bribes Politician to influence her decisions. Actual Autocrat's tax policy may be different from the announced one. If the difference is large, then Public may revolt or Oligarch may organize a coup to throw Autocrat down. It is shown that the probability of democracy preservation is decreasing in the amount of resources if the institutional quality is low enough. It does not depend on the amount of resources, if the institutional quality is higher than a threshold. The level of the threshold, however, depends positively on the resource wealth. We have found also that under very low institutional quality, a paradoxical effect takes place: the probability of democracy preservation may decrease with small improvements of institutional quality. It is shown as well that Oligarch earns larger part of rent under democracy than under autocracy. This result conforms to empirical observation which is demonstrated in the paper: under low quality of institutions, democratization leads to higher inequality and inequality entails worsening of the attitude to democracy

    Динамика органной дисфункции и маркеров воспаления у пациентов с септическим шоком при мультимодальной гемокоррекции: мультицентровое, рандомизированное, контролируемое исследование

    АКТУАЛЬНОСТЬ: Септический шок считается наиболее серьезным осложнением в интенсивной медицине и сопровождается значительной летальностью. Экстракорпоральная гемокоррекция может улучшить результаты лечения пациентов с септическим шоком. ЦЕЛЬ ИССЛЕДОВАНИЯ: оценка влияния гемокоррекции с помощью мультимодального адсорбента «Эфферон ЛПС» на динамику органной дисфункции и маркеры воспаления у пациентов с септическим шоком. МАТЕРИАЛЫ И МЕТОДЫ: Мультицентровое рандомизированное контролируемое исследование проведено в четырех медицинских организациях города Москвы (НИИ СП им. Н.Ф. Склифосовского ДЗМ, ГКБ № 1 им. Н.И. Пирогова ДЗМ, ГКБ им. С.С. Юдина ДЗМ, ГКБ № 68 им. В.П. Демихова ДЗМ) с марта 2021 г. по май 2022 г. В исследование включены 58 пациентов (29 мужчин и 29 женщин) с септическим шоком. Рандомизацию проводили в соотношении 2:1 (гемоперфузия: контроль). Не позднее 24 ч после включения пациента в исследование выполняли процедуры селективной гемоперфузии или использовали стандартную терапию. Гемосорбцию с использованием «Эфферон ЛПС» проводили двукратно, с интервалом 24,5 (23,3–26,0) ч. РЕЗУЛЬТАТЫ: Применение селективного гемосорбента «Эфферон ЛПС» позволило уже через 72 ч снизить тяжесть органной дисфункции у пациентов с септическим шоком с 7 до 3 баллов по шкале SOFA (Sequential Organ Failure Assessment) за счет улучшения гемодинамики, респираторной и почечной функции. В отличие от контрольной группы, в группе «Эфферон ЛПС» уже через 72 ч значимо снижался уровень С-реактивного белка (СРБ) в 1,5 раза, прокальцитонина (ПКТ) — в 2,7 раза, интерлейкина-6 — в 2,3 раза. Тяжесть органной дисфункции значимо коррелировала с уровнем СРБ (r = 0,346) и ПКТ (r = 0,444). Длительность госпитализации выживших пациентов составила 16,1 и 30,1 дня в группе «Эфферон ЛПС» и контрольной группе соответственно (p = 0,032). Потребность в проведении заместительной почечной терапии у выживших к 3-м суткам значимо снижалась с 73,7 до 33,3 % только в группе «Эфферон ЛПС», но не в контрольной группе. ВЫВОДЫ: Применение селективного гемосорбента «Эфферон ЛПС» позволило уменьшить выраженность системного воспаления и значимо снизить тяжесть органной дисфункции у пациентов с септическим шоком за счет улучшения показателей гемодинамики, газообмена и почечной функции

    Two-particle correlations in azimuthal angle and pseudorapidity in inelastic p + p interactions at the CERN Super Proton Synchrotron

    Results on two-particle ΔηΔϕ correlations in inelastic p + p interactions at 20, 31, 40, 80, and 158 GeV/c are presented. The measurements were performed using the large acceptance NA61/SHINE hadron spectrometer at the CERN Super Proton Synchrotron. The data show structures which can be attributed mainly to effects of resonance decays, momentum conservation, and quantum statistics.     Alteration in Superoxide Dismutase 1 Causes Oxidative Stress and p38 MAPK Activation Following RVFV Infection

    Rift Valley fever (RVF) is a zoonotic disease caused by Rift Valley fever virus (RVFV). RVFV is a category A pathogen that belongs to the genus Phlebovirus, family Bunyaviridae. Understanding early host events to an infectious exposure to RVFV will be of significant use in the development of effective therapeutics that not only control pathogen multiplication, but also contribute to cell survival. In this study, we have carried out infections of human cells with a vaccine strain (MP12) and virulent strain (ZH501) of RVFV and determined host responses to viral infection. We demonstrate that the cellular antioxidant enzyme superoxide dismutase 1 (SOD1) displays altered abundances at early time points following exposure to the virus. We show that the enzyme is down regulated in cases of both a virulent (ZH501) and a vaccine strain (MP12) exposure. Our data demonstrates that the down regulation of SOD1 is likely to be due to post transcriptional processes and may be related to up regulation of TNFα following infection. We also provide evidence for extensive oxidative stress in the MP12 infected cells. Concomitantly, there is an increase in the activation of the p38 MAPK stress response, which our earlier published study demonstrated to be an essential cell survival strategy. Our data suggests that the viral anti-apoptotic protein NSm may play a role in the regulation of the cellular p38 MAPK response. Alterations in the host protein SOD1 following RVFV infection appears to be an early event that occurs in multiple cell types. Activation of the cellular stress response p38 MAPK pathway can be observed in all cell types tested. Our data implies that maintaining oxidative homeostasis in the infected cells may play an important role in improving survival of infected cells
